    About this property

    • Broomhayes Farm is a substantial Country House situated quietly off Inmarsh Lane in an elevated position, overlooking its own paddock and adjoining farmland. The house offers well balanced and flexible family accommodation with great charm and character, sitting centrally within its grounds. All of the principal rooms capitalise on the views over the formal garden, lawns and across miles of incredibly beautiful rural countryside to the edge of Salisbury Plain.

      The property is entered through a large wooden front door with a pretty architrave above, opening into a large, bright entrance hall with stone floor, exposed beams and a balcony feature from the upstairs landing directly opposite the entrance. All the main rooms lead off the entrance hall and a door at the opposite end leads out to the south facing terrace and garden. To the left of the hall is the substantial kitchen/breakfast room, complete with wall and base units, a central island and Aga at one end and the breakfast area at the other looking out to the glorious countryside views.

      To the right of the hall is a large dining room comfortably seating 10 and also enjoying views over the garden. Of particular note is the elegant double drawing room, with high ceilings enjoying superb natural light from the six bay windows. The drawing room has wooden floors, a log burner and a door opening out onto the terrace and beautiful rural views. There is also a cosy study/snug with an open fireplace and window overlooking the garden.

      To complete the downstairs, to the immediate right of the front door is a utility room and separate boot room and WC. Leading past the utility room, is a large tucked away playroom that could also be used as a home office.

      On the first floor is the south facing principal bedroom, again showcasing the far-reaching views over the valley. This beautiful suite is complimented by a dressing room, en suite bathroom and study area. There are six further double bedrooms, one with an en suite bathroom and a further family bathroom and separate shower room. All bedrooms show the diverse views of the house, be it the rural countryside, woodland, paddocks or the mature gardens.

      GARDENS AND GROUNDS

      The property is approached over a gravel drive leading through a small copse with a box hedge on either side to a concrete and gravel parking and turning area flanked to one side by a pleached hornbeam hedge. The formal gardens, with rose beds bordered by box and yew hedges lie to the south at the front of the house and are approached by a large flagstone terrace perfect for al-fresco dining. Beyond the formal garden is a further flat lawned area with magnificent views over the field owned by the property and across many miles of rural countryside beyond. Further lawned areas surround the property with a large amount of newly planted trees supplementing some magnificent mature specimens.

      The property sits within approx. 6.7 acres of land which consists of woodland, a babbling brook fed by a spring that leads to two ponds. There is a paddock and field, hard surface tennis court and a second entrance from the road providing access to the land owned by the property.

      There are a number of attractive outbuildings providing useful storage, namely a period Cow Byre and other storage areas surrounding an enclosed courtyard that could be converted into separate accommodation or office space, subject to obtaining the necessary planning consent.

    Local information

    • Broomhayes Farm occupies a sought after 'edge of village' location and is within very close proximity of the highly desirable village of Seend, renowned for its many fine period buildings which adjoin the High Street. There are many local amenities within the village including a local store and Post Office, primary school, three public houses, church, village hall and community centre. The larger regional centres of Devizes, Marlborough and Chippenham are within easy reach. Extensive facilities are available in Devizes with many independent retailers, restaurants and a weekly farmers market and Marlborough has a delightful High Street with many shops including Waitrose.
    • The Neolithic sites of Stonehenge and Avebury are both approximately 30 minutes distant, and there are many opportunities for walking, riding and other country pursuits in the surrounding countryside. The Cathedral cities of Bath and Salisbury are both within 17 miles and 27 miles respectively.
    • The M4 provides access to London, Heathrow Airport and the West Country. There are rail services to London Paddington from Chippenham (57 mins fastest and 71 mins ), Westbury ( 1 hour 24 mins ) or Pewsey ( 58 mins fastest and 67 mins ).
    • This part of Wiltshire is renowned for its many well-regarded schools including Marlborough College, Dauntseys, St. Margaret's Preparatory School and St. Mary's Calne, amongst others.
